These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Ruby area can be challenging. Home prices in Ruby are now at a median cost of $71,000, lower than the Alaska average of $254,370.
The average cost of rent is $625/mo in Ruby,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Ruby area. While nearly 89.94% of residents own their homes outright in Ruby, 24.55%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Ruby is $2,732 per month. Households that rent pay about 22.88% of their income on rent here. Ruby's most expensive areas are in the northern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the northwestern parts of the city.
